Warning Signs You Need Roof Leak Water Removal
Ignoring these warning signs can lead to costly repairs and even health risks. Don’t wait until it’s too late. Our team is here to help you identify and address the issue quickly.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ors in your home or office could be a sign of hidden Water Damage or mold growth. Don’t ignore it; our team can help you identify the source and provide a solution.
Warped or Discolored Ceiling Tiles
Changes in ceiling tile appearance can show water damage or leaks. Our team can assess and repair the issue before it becomes a bigger problem.
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ings
Visible water stains on your walls or ceilings are a clear indication of a roof leak or water damage. Our team can help you repair and restore the affected areas.
Mineral Deposits or Stains on Floors
Mineral deposits or stains on your floors can be a sign of hidden water damage or leaks. Our team can help you identify the source and provide a solution.
Persistent Leaks or Water Droplets
Leaks or water droplets around your property can be a sign of a roof leak or water damage. Don’t ignore it; our team can help you identify and repair the issue.
Unpleasant Musty Smells in Your Attic or Crawlspace
Musty smells in your attic or crawlspace can show hidden water damage or mold growth. Our team can help you identify the source and provide a solution.

Roof Leak Water Removal Cost in Balch Springs, TX
The cost of roof leak water removal in Balch Springs, TX, varies depending on the severity of the leak,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on our experience and can serve as a guide. Keep in mind that prices may vary, and an on-site assessment is necessary to find out the exact cost.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ction and Dr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of leak, and equipment used. |
| Content Protection and Cleaning | $200 – $1,000 | Number of items affected, type of materials, and cleaning complexity. |
| Repair and Restoration | $1,000 – $10,000+ | Scope of repairs, materials required, and labor costs. |
| Final Inspection and Verification | $100 – $500 | Complexity of the issue, number of areas inspected, and verification requirements. |
| More Services (e.g., mold remediation) | $500 – $5,000+ | Scope of more services required, materials, and labor costs. |

Common Questions About Roof Leak Water Removal
What is the typical timeline for roof leak water removal?
The timeline for roof leak water removal can vary depending on the severity of the leak, the size of the affected area, and the complexity of the issue. Our team works efficiently to ensure the process is completed as quickly as possible, typically within 3-5 days.
Is roof leak water removal covered by insurance?
Yes, roof leak water removal is often covered by insurance. But, the specifics of your policy and the extent of coverage depend on your provider and the circumstances of the leak. Our team can guide you through the insurance claims process and help you navigate any complexities.
Can roof leak water removal cause health risks?
Yes, roof leak water removal can pose health risks if not handled properly. Exposed surfaces and water-damaged areas can harbor mold, bacteria, and other contaminants. Our team takes necessary precautions to ensure a safe and healthy environment for you and your family.
What equipment does your team use for roof leak water removal?
Our team uses advanced equipment, including but not limited to: water extraction vacuums, desiccants, and specialized cleaning solutions. We also use thermal imaging cameras to detect hidden water damage and ensure a thorough drying process.
